About this listen
In this episode of Real Talk with Star Scorpio, we sit down with Garie Adamson, the founder of the iconic Toronto brand 100 Miles — a name stitched into the legacy of hip-hop culture.From Scarborough to global recognition, Garie shares how 100 Miles went from a local vision to a movement worn by Tupac in Above the Rim, and later by Drake courtside at a Raptors game. He speaks on encounters with Biggie Smalls, Redman, and his journey as one of Canada's fashion pioneers in the street and hip-hop space.This isn’t just fashion. It’s history.
